Abstract
The present experiment was designed to study the effect of supplementation of Trehalose on freezability and antioxidant activity of Hariana bull semen. Semen samples were diluted in TFYG extender containing different concentrations of Trehalose (10 mM, 30 mM & 50 mM). The control samples were extended with TFYG alone. Results clearly indicated that, 30 mM Trehalose group had significantly (P<0.05) higher percentage of individual sperm motility, sperm viability, and intact acrosome in comparison to the control and other Trehalose supplemented groups. In biochemical assays, no clear-cut demarcation for antioxidant enzyme was found for Trehalose supplementation. However, Trehalose supplementation has showed increase activity for Glutathione reductase (GR). The results obtained clearly indicated that supplementation of Trehalose (30 mM) to extender prior to cryopreservation improves Hariana bull sperm quality. [ABSTRACT FROM AUTHOR]
